The successful bidder will be responsible for the following:
· Obtain Fire permit and on-site inspection approval of all work required to remove the two (2) above-ground storage tanks by the Town of Hammonton Construction Office. All coordination with the Construction Office, cost to prepare and submit the permit application form(s), and permit fee(s) shall be the responsibility of the successful bidder.
· Flush or pump any existing fuel out of each existing fuel tank to prevent the spill of any residual fuel when disconnecting the tanks from the underground piping.
· Flush or pump any existing fuel out of the existing piping to prevent the spill of any residual fuel.
· Disconnect both tanks from the underground piping.
· Properly disconnect and terminate electric to (2) fuel pumps. Remove and properly dispose of (2) fuel pumps, canopy, concrete, and all other components associated with fuel tanks.
· Cap below grade the ends of the existing piping and the piping connection point of each fuel tank to provide an airtight seal. Potential recommended methods to seal the piping include crimping the ends of the piping or via the installation of cement, grout, or expansive foam to plug the end of each pipe.
· Remove each tank from the concrete pad and haul away.
· Remove and properly dispose of all concrete, fencing, bollards, and all other components associated with fuel tanks.
· Ensure the entire site is left in a condition equal to or better than the condition prior to the start of any work to remove the tanks.
· If any damage is done to the site, including but not limited to the spill of residual fuel, the site shall be restored to a condition equal to or better than the condition prior to the start of any work to remove the tanks and at no additional cost to the District. The cost to remediate any fuel spill resulting from this work shall be borne by the successful bidder and will NOT be the responsibility of the District.
